Aurangabad Airport and Rail
Book your flights to Aurangabad Airport (IXU), which offers daily connections to Mumbai, Delhi, and other Indian metros. The airport is compact, efficient, and only 10 km from the city center—prepaid taxis and ride apps are at the arrivals gate for fast city access. Aurangabad’s railway station is a major stop on Central Railway, making train travel a popular alternative for budget adventurers or overnight journeys.

Popular Markets in Aurangabad
Aurangabad’s markets pulse with youth and color—Paithan Gate is your go-to for Paithani sarees and Himroo shawls, Gulmandi for jewelry and crafts, and Nirala Bazaar for quirky fashion and gadgets. Stock up on Bidriware souvenirs, handmade slippers, and locally made sweets before your flight home.

Must Visit Places In Aurangabad
Beyond the Ajanta and Ellora Caves (UNESCO icons), check out Bibi Ka Maqbara (“Mini Taj”), Daulatabad Fort, Panchakki (the water mill), and the Siddharth Garden & Zoo. Join the city’s walking tours for fresh angles and local stories. And don’t miss evening sound-and-light shows at Daulatabad!

Nashik Airport and Rail
Ozar Airport (ISK) is 20 km from the city and connects Nashik with Mumbai, Delhi, Bengaluru, and more.
